19-Year-Old Killed by Garbage Truck in Queens

A 19-year-old woman was struck and killed by a garbage truck late Sunday night in the Woodside neighborhood of Queens, New York. The incident occurred just before midnight at the intersection of 62nd Street and Roosevelt Avenue.

Why it matters

Pedestrian safety and the operation of large commercial vehicles in dense urban areas are ongoing concerns, especially in New York City where traffic accidents involving vulnerable road users like pedestrians and cyclists are a persistent issue.

The details

According to police, the woman was struck by the garbage truck at the intersection. The truck driver remained at the scene, and the investigation into the incident is ongoing.

  • The incident occurred just before midnight on Sunday, March 30, 2026.
